Transaction 15037f17e89134d2aa2c3faa94fd87ad61348e1777ab40e2f457a6cdff79ddb6

2 Input
2 Outputs
  • 15037f17e89134d2aa2c3faa94fd87ad61348e1777ab40e2f457a6cdff79ddb6:0
  • value  8807120
    address  1L2LwPHWo3peu4UQx89zDMeqy7zWUWMkPn
  • 15037f17e89134d2aa2c3faa94fd87ad61348e1777ab40e2f457a6cdff79ddb6:1
  • value  37010789
    address  31vtc2CsZ1Wj6kFcTSBhMrfoctEvSiiahZ